Potatoes Lorraine

Ingredients
- 5 cups sliced unpeeled potatoes4 ounces bacon, cut into small pieces, partially cooked
- 1/2 cup chopped green onions
- 1/8 teaspoon onion powder
- 1/8 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/8 teaspoon salt
- 1/8 teaspoon black pepper
- 3 cups shredded Gruyère cheese

Preparation
Step 1
1Preheat oven to 350ºF. Grease a 9 × 9-inch baking dish.
.2Layer half the potatoes, bacon, green onions, onion powder, garlic powder, salt and black pepper in prepared baking dish. Sprinkle half the Gruyère on top of the potatoes. Repeat layers.
.3Cover with foil. Bake until potatoes are tender and cheese is melted, about 1 hour.
.4Remove foil. Bake for 10 minutes longer. Cut into squares to serve.
